Afaraukwu Kingdom Declares One Month Prayer, Fasting for Kanu’s Release

0

As part of efforts to ensure that their son and detained leader of the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B), Mazi Nnamdi Kanu, is released unconditionally, Traditional Rulers, The Afaraukwu Development Union, and the entire people of Afaraukwu kingdom over the weekend, went spiritual by declaring a month fasting and prayer for God to touch the hearts of those concerned.

The Traditional Rulers and members of the Afaraukwu Development Union noted that amid the prevailing circumstance, they strongly believe that having spent quite a long time in detention, several wounds possibly created by the impasse must have been healed.

They applauded President Bola Ahmed Tinubu for welcoming calls and appeals from notable groups, organizations, bodies, well meaning Nigerians soliciting his release, stressing that time has indeed come to show mercy by releasing their son.

The Traditional Rulers and members of the Afaraukwu Development Union added their voice to that of other Nigerians, groups and organizations who are genuinely seeking for the release of Nnamdi Kanu in the interest of peace and security of life and property of the South-East geo-political zone.

Those including His Royal Highness, Edward Ibeabuchi, President Development Union, Sunny Apugo among others who spoke at the event, noted that the arrest and subsequent detention of Mazi Nnamdi Kanu has elucidated reactions and heightened tensions in the South-East region

They, however, prayed President Tinubu and the Judiciary to kindly hearken to the patriotic calls and appeals of all Nigerians at home and diaspora to please release him while also urging him to consider political solution and the trauma the immediate family of the detained IPOB leader is passing through, and free him from detention.

They equally singled out and appreciated the South-East Governors led by Governor Hope Uzodinma of Imo state, Governor of Abia State Alex Otti, South-East Senators led by Senator Enyinnaya Abaribe, member Representing Ikwuano/Umuahia Federal Constituency Hon Obi Aguocha, member Representing Umuahia Central State Constituency Hon. Chinasa Anthony among others, who, according to them, have worked tirelessly towards the release of the IPOB leader.
